Eaton Components Enable GAIG to Release Cotton Harvester with All-Hydraulic Design Offering Improved Drivability and Productivity

Date: May 24, 2012

EDEN PRAIRIE, Minn. … Diversified industrial manufacturer Eaton Corporation today announced that Guizhou Aviation Industry Group (GAIG) Agriculture Equipment Company, Ltd. of Shihezi, Xinjiang, China, the country’s largest producer of cotton harvesting equipment, is equipping its large, self-propelled 4MZ-5 cotton harvesters with an all-hydraulic design featuring Eaton® products that have helped improve drivability and productivity. 

GAIG’s next generation 4MZ-5 harvesters feature an Eaton heavy-duty hydrostatic transmission, open-circuit piston pump, valve manifolds, steering unit and motor supplied by Eaton in China.

In addition to its total hydraulic package design expertise, Eaton was awarded GAIG’s business based on its application and technical support strengths, resulting in ongoing batch supply orders since January 2011.
